BS EN 60891:1995 Procedures for temperature and irradiance corrections to measured I-V characteristics of crystalline silicon photovoltaic devices

BS EN 60891:1995 is a British Standard that pertains to the measurement and characterization of photovoltaic (PV) devices. It provides guidelines and procedures for determining the electrical and optical performance of PV devices, including solar cells and modules. The standard outlines various test methods for measuring parameters such as open-circuit voltage, short-circuit current, maximum power point, spectral responsivity, and electrical resistance. It aims to ensure accurate and consistent evaluation of PV devices for performance assessment and comparison purposes.
